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5454 664 78
2859 35385290637 23
2859 35385290637 23
029716 52391444 101
All about undefined
Interested in learning more?
2859 35385290637 23
029716 52391444 101
See more
3388029654 99347451 45423903848
11387 646846635 36
See more
8242465091 3730747042 9006722
357 18366 94954545 41691 082495353
See more